    Enhancing Travel Convenience and Choice:

    • Personalized Experience: Minibuses offer a more intimate and personalized travel experience compared to large coaches. Smaller groups allow for interaction with the driver, potential flexibility with stops (upon request), and a more comfortable journey.
    • Door-to-Door Service: Many minibus companies offer door-to-door service, picking passengers up directly from Manchester Airport and dropping them off at their chosen location in Leicester. This eliminates the hassle of navigating public transport connections, especially for those unfamiliar with the area.
    • Catering to Smaller Groups: Minibuses are perfectly suited for smaller groups (typically 8-16 passengers). Traveling with friends or family becomes a more social and comfortable experience compared to sharing a large coach with strangers.

    Challenges and Considerations:

    • Limited Availability: Compared to large coaches, minibuses tend to have smaller fleets and operate fewer scheduled services. It’s essential to book in advance, especially during peak seasons.
    • Higher Cost per Passenger (in some cases): Depending on the group size and total cost, minibuses can sometimes be more expensive per passenger compared to large coaches.
    • Potential Environmental Impact: If minibuses operate with a low passenger occupancy rate, their environmental benefits diminish.
